Master Gradle in Mumbai: Expert-Led Training for DevOps Professionals

In today’s fast-paced software development landscape, the ability to automate, streamline, and reliably manage the build process is not just an advantage—it’s a necessity. As projects grow in complexity, teams need robust tools that can handle diverse requirements, from simple Java applications to intricate multi-language enterprise systems. This is where Gradle shines, and for professionals in Mumbai looking to master this powerful build automation tool, DevOpsSchool offers a comprehensive and expertly guided training program. This blog post will delve into the details of their Gradle Training in Mumbai, exploring why it’s a critical investment for your career and how DevOpsSchool stands out as the premier learning destination.

Why Gradle? The Modern Build Automation Champion

Before we explore the training specifics, let’s understand the “why.” Gradle has emerged as the build tool of choice for many organizations, eclipsing older tools like Ant and Maven in flexibility and performance. It combines the best of both worlds: the declarative, convention-over-configuration approach of Maven with the powerful, programmable flexibility of Ant. Using a Groovy or Kotlin-based DSL, Gradle allows developers to write build scripts that are both concise and expressive.

Key Advantages of Gradle:

  • High Performance: Utilizes advanced caching and daemon processes to drastically reduce build times.
  • JVM Foundation: Runs on the Java Virtual Machine, making it a natural fit for Java projects but extensible to many other languages like C++, Python, and JavaScript.
  • Incremental Builds: Smartly determines which parts of the project are up-to-date, rebuilding only what is necessary.
  • Extensibility: A rich plugin ecosystem and the ability to write custom tasks and plugins make it adaptable to virtually any project workflow.
  • Declarative and Imperative: Supports declarative dependency management while allowing imperative logic for complex automation needs.

For developers, DevOps engineers, and SREs in Mumbai’s vibrant tech hub, proficiency in Gradle is a highly marketable skill that aligns with the city’s leading role in India’s software innovation.

DevOpsSchool’s Gradle Training in Mumbai: A Curriculum Designed for Mastery

DevOpsSchool’s training is not a superficial overview; it’s a deep dive designed to take you from foundational concepts to advanced implementation. The course is structured to cater to beginners with basic programming knowledge as well as experienced professionals seeking to standardize and optimize their build pipelines.

Detailed Course Modules and Learning Objectives

The Gradle course curriculum is meticulously crafted to cover all essential and advanced aspects:

Module 1: Introduction to Build Automation & Gradle

  • Understanding the evolution of build tools (Make, Ant, Maven, Gradle).
  • Gradle’s philosophy: Convention, Configuration, and Flexibility.
  • Setting up the Gradle environment on Windows, macOS, and Linux.

Module 2: Gradle Fundamentals

  • Understanding Projects, Tasks, and the Build Lifecycle.
  • Writing and executing your first build.gradle script.
  • Deep dive into Gradle Tasks: Task dependencies, actions, and properties.

Module 3: Dependency Management with Gradle

  • Configuring repositories (Maven Central, JCenter, custom).
  • Declaring dependencies for different configurations (implementation, testImplementation, etc.).
  • Handling dependency conflicts and version catalogs.

Module 4: The Gradle Wrapper

  • Importance of the Gradle Wrapper for consistent, reproducible builds.
  • Generating and using the wrapper in projects.

Module 5: Multi-Project Builds

  • Structuring a complex application with multiple subprojects.
  • Configuring cross-project task dependencies and shared configurations.

Module 6: Writing Custom Plugins and Tasks

  • Extending Gradle’s functionality by creating custom tasks in build scripts.
  • Developing standalone plugins in Groovy/Kotlin for reusability across projects.

Module 7: Gradle Integration in CI/CD Pipelines

  • Automating builds with Jenkins, GitLab CI, and GitHub Actions.
  • Best practices for speed and reliability in continuous integration.

Module 8: Advanced Topics & Best Practices

  • Performance tuning and build scans for diagnostics.
  • Testing builds with Gradle TestKit.
  • Migration strategies from Maven/Ant to Gradle.

What Sets This Gradle Training Apart?

FeatureDevOpsSchool Advantage
Expert MentorshipDirect guidance from Rajesh Kumar, a global expert with over 20 years of experience.
Training FormatAvailable as instructor-led online live classes or in-person batches in Mumbai, offering flexibility.
Hands-On ApproachThe course is lab-intensive, with real-world projects and scenarios to solidify learning.
Career SupportIncludes resume preparation, interview questions, and certification guidance.
Community AccessJoin a network of alumni and professionals for continuous learning and networking.

The DevOpsSchool Advantage: Learn from the Pioneers

Choosing the right training provider is as crucial as choosing the right technology. DevOpsSchool has established itself as a leading platform for cutting-edge courses in DevOps, SRE, Cloud, and related domains. Their Gradle training in Mumbai is a testament to their commitment to quality education.

The program is governed and mentored by none other than Rajesh Kumar . With a stellar career spanning over two decades, Rajesh is a globally recognized trainer and consultant in DevOps, DevSecOps, SRE, DataOps, AIOps, MLOps, Kubernetes, and Cloud. His wealth of practical experience ensures that the training content is not just theoretically sound but also grounded in real-world challenges and solutions. Learning from an authority of his caliber provides invaluable insights that go far beyond standard textbook knowledge.

Who Should Enroll in This Gradle Course?

This training is ideally suited for:

  • Software Developers who want to master their project’s build process.
  • DevOps Engineers aiming to streamline and automate CI/CD pipelines.
  • Build and Release Engineers seeking a powerful tool to manage complex builds.
  • Technical Leads and Architects who need to design scalable and efficient build systems for their teams.
  • QA Automation Engineers involved in integrating testing into the build lifecycle.
  • Anyone in Mumbai’s tech community looking to add a high-demand skill to their portfolio.

Investing in Your Future: Certification and Career Growth

Upon successful completion of the Gradle training, participants receive a certificate from DevOpsSchool, a valuable addition to your professional profile that validates your expertise. In a competitive job market, this certification can be the differentiator that catches a recruiter’s eye.

Mastering Gradle opens doors to roles such as:

  • Build and Automation Engineer
  • Senior DevOps Engineer
  • Platform Engineer
  • Software Development Engineer in Test (SDET)
  • Cloud Infrastructure Engineer

The skills you gain empower you to contribute directly to your organization’s developer productivity, software quality, and time-to-market—metrics that are highly valued in any tech-driven company.

Conclusion: Take the Next Step in Your Automation Journey

The demand for efficient, scalable, and maintainable build automation is only going to increase. Gradle, with its powerful features and growing adoption, is at the forefront of this space. For professionals in Mumbai, DevOpsSchool’s Gradle Training offers the perfect blend of foundational knowledge, advanced skills, and expert mentorship to become proficient in this essential tool.

Don’t just learn to use Gradle—learn to master it and leverage it to build faster, more reliable, and more sophisticated software systems. Elevate your technical capabilities and position yourself at the forefront of modern software engineering practices.

Ready to automate your way to success?

Contact DevOpsSchool today to enroll in the next batch of Gradle Training in Mumbai or to inquire about their other expert-led courses.

Email: contact@DevOpsSchool.com
Phone & WhatsApp (India): +91 84094 92687
Phone & WhatsApp (USA): +1 (469) 756-6329

Visit DevOpsSchool to explore their full catalog of trainings and certifications designed to propel your career forward.

Categories:

Related Posts :-